Chijioke Alaekwe and Abba Umar scored a goal each as Gombe United ran out 2-0 winners over Heartland at the Pantami Stadium in Gombe in one of Sunday’s Nigeria Premier Football League (NPFL) matches.

Umar scored Gombe United’s quickest-ever NPFL goal to help set up a comfortable victory over a blunt Heartland side as the Savannah Scorpions pull further from the drop zone while visitors fell to the basement of the standings.

The midfielder found the net after just 26 seconds as Heartland were caught trying to play out from the back. The goal is the fifth fastest in NPFL history and the first that Gombe United have scored in the opening minute of a league match.

The hosts’ evening was made worse by a first-half injury to Bashiru Monsuru, who looked set to miss more game time with a hamstring problem. But the lack of end product from the likes of Mustapha Jibrin at the other end of the pitch remained just as big an issue.

The second goal for Gombe United arrived in the 57th minute. It was Emeka Isaac’s pass out from the back intercepted by Clement and Matthias Samuel played through to Alaekwe who coolly angled beyond Heartland goalkeeper for his second goal of the term.

With the result almost already assured, Gombe United head coach Mohammed Baba Ganaru introduced fresh legs by substituting both of his goalscorers Umar and Alaekwe with Taiye Yusuf and Ahmed Jimoh respectively.

The win takes Gombe United into 14th place and two points clear off the drop zone. They travel to Akure for their next match against Sunshine Stars while Heartland play hosts to Akwa United.
